Review of the T31 generation: why it is still in demand

Model Nissan X-Trail T31 debuted in 2007 as the second generation of the legendary crossover. Unlike its predecessor (T30), new X-Trail received a more modern design, improved sound insulation and an expanded range of engines. On the Russian market, the car was offered with gasoline units QR25DE (2.5 l, 169 hp) and MR20DE (2.0 l, 141 hp), as well as diesel M9R (2.0 l, 150–173 hp).

The main reasons for popularity T31 today:

  • 🔧 Simple and maintainable design — the absence of complex electronics (in basic versions) simplifies maintenance.
  • 🚗 Reliable all-wheel drive system All Mode 4×4-i with center differential lock (in versions with MR20DE And M9R).
  • 💰 Reasonable prices for spare parts - many details are unified with Nissan Qashqai J10 And Renault Koleos.
  • 🛋️ Spacious salon with the possibility of transformation (folding the second row into a flat floor).

However, there are also nuances: for example, body corrosion - weak point T31, especially in the rear arches and sills. The owners also note noisy diesel engine M9R when cold and problems with the turbine after 200 thousand km.

Diesel vs gasoline: which is more profitable in 2026

Choosing between petrol and diesel X-Trail T31 - one of the most controversial issues. Let's look at the pros and cons of each option:

Gasoline engines (MR20DE And QR25DE):

  • Cheaper to maintain — there is no need to frequently change oil and fuel filters.
  • Less problems in winter — there is no risk of fuel freezing (relevant for regions with harsh climates).
  • Quieter operation - especially important for urban use.
  • High fuel consumption - in the city QR25DE can consume up to 14 l/100 km.

Diesel engine (M9R):

  • Economical — consumption in the combined cycle does not exceed 7–8 l/100 km.
  • High torque (320–360 Nm) - better for towing and off-road.
  • Resource up to 400 thousand km with proper maintenance.
  • Expensive maintenance — replacing the timing belt, turbine and fuel equipment costs 2–3 times more than gasoline versions.
  • Sensitivity to fuel quality — Russian diesel fuel can reduce the life of the fuel system.

🔹 Conclusion: diesel is justified if you drive more than 20 thousand km annually or often travel outdoors. For city use it is better to choose a petrol version with MR20DE.

What happens if you don’t change the oil in the X-Trail T31 automatic transmission?

If you ignore the regulations (change every 60 thousand km), the oil in the machine RE0F10A loses properties, which leads to:

- Jerking when changing gears.

- Overheating of the box and failure of the clutches.

- Damage to the hydraulic unit (repair will cost 100+ thousand rubles).

Symptoms of a “tired” automatic transmission: delays when switching, jolts, burnt oil smell.

Typical problems and how to avoid them

Despite the reliability Nissan X-Trail T31 has a number of “diseases” that you should know about in advance:

1. Body corrosion:

  • 🔍 Vulnerabilities: rear arches, sills, lower part of doors.
  • 🛠️ Solution: regular anticorrosive treatment (every 2 years) and installation of mudguards.

2. Problems with automatic transmission (RE0F10A):

  • ⚠️ Symptoms: jerking, delays when switching, oil leakage.
  • 🔧 Prevention: oil change every 60 thousand km (original Nissan Matic-S).

3. Diesel M9R:

  • 🔥 Turbine: resource - 150–200 thousand km. Signs of malfunction: smoky exhaust, loss of power.
  • ⚙️ Injection pump and injectors: sensitive to fuel quality. It is recommended to use additives (for example, Liqui Moly Diesel Additiv).

4. Suspension:

  • 🚗 Wheel bearings: They fail at 100–120 thousand km. Symptom: hum when driving.
  • 🔩 Silent blocks: require replacement every 80–100 thousand km.

Which X-Trail T31 engine is the most reliable?

Gasoline is considered the most reliable MR20DE (2.0 l). It is easier to maintain, less sensitive to fuel quality and has a service life of up to 300 thousand km with regular oil changes. Diesel M9R more powerful and more economical, but requires more careful maintenance and high-quality fuel.

Is it possible to install gas equipment on the X-Trail T31?

Yes, but only for petrol versions (MR20DE And QR25DE). For diesel M9R HBO is not suitable. It is recommended to install 4th generation equipment (for example, Lovato or BRC) with a separate cylinder in the trunk. The average cost of installation is 50–70 thousand rubles.

What kind of oil to pour into the X-Trail T31 automatic transmission?

For automatic transmission RE0F10A you must use original oil Nissan Matic-S (article KE908-99932). Analogues: Mobil ATF 3309 or Idemitsu ATF Type-J. The volume for a complete replacement is 8–9 liters.
